JavaScript is not enabled.
A+ Automotive Repair - Review by asldjff a | A L T A Automotive

A L T A Automotive

Claim

A+ Automotive Repair 8/20/2005

Alta Automotive is an all service automotive repair service. Transmissions, police cars, engines, road noise, new tires, or just any problems at all can be fixed at Alta Automotive. Alta Automotive is also very affordable, and they have quick service. I would highly recommend Alta Automotive to anybody needing minor or major automotive work. more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021